Senior Data Engineer

Jornada completa

Turing

A U.S.-based company, that is changing the way people consume dairy and revolutionizing vegan protein-rich products, is looking for a Senior Data Engineer. The selected engineer will collaborate with the data science and engineering team as well as provide technical leadership and utilize their expertise with cloud computing to design and deploy data engineering processes. The company is on a mission to change how people consume their food by making the process more transparent and ethical. This company has been successful in raising over $700 Million during their Series D round of funding. 

 

Job Responsibilities:

  • Develop data pipelines, databases, and overall data lake architecture
  • Design and implement an analytical environment using third-party and in-house tools 
  • Use Python to improve and automate analytics, ETL, and data quality platform
  • Build and deploy complex data models and model metadata
  • Create reports and dashboards
  • Take ownership of data dashboarding and presentation tools for the end users of our data products and systems
  • Conduct and support ingestion and migration of data in multiple types and formats 
  • Partake in data retrieval, integration, and analysis
  • Understand data trends by analyzing collected data to establish facts
  • Deploy developed data solutions, user applications, databases, etc
  • Work closely with internal and third-party data producers, consumers, and users
  • Collaborate with non-technical stakeholders
  • Analyze, understand, and document existing workflows
  • Conduct integration and data structuring activities

Job Requirements:

  • Bachelor’s/Master’s degree in Engineering, Computer Science (or equivalent experience)
  • At least 8+ years of relevant experience as a Data Engineer
  • Experience with ETL, Data Modeling, and Data Architecture (at least 8-10 years)
  • Expertise in writing and optimizing SQL
  • Previous experience developing scripting software solutions using Linux/Unix 
  • Operational experience in large data warehouses or data lakes
  • Demonstrable experience with AWS technologies, Databricks, Benchling, and Glue
  • Previous understanding of Lambda, and RDS (PostgreSQL, MySQL)
  • Expert-level skills in ETL optimization, designing, coding, and using Apache Spark or similar technologies to tune big data processes
  • Background developing applications and data pipelines to process and stream datasets at low latencies
  • Ability to track data - track data lineage, ensure data quality, and improve data discoverability 
  • Sound understanding of distributed systems and data architecture (Lambda)
  • Ability to design and implement batch and stream data processing pipelines
  • Understanding of how to optimize the distribution, partitioning, and MPP of high-level data structures
  • Background in life science data a plus
  • Familiarity with Docker
  • Ability to clearly express ideas, listen, question, and share valuable information with colleagues 
  • Effective presentation skills and the ability to communicate ideas to technical and non-technical audiences
  • Great to possess high energy and enthusiasm to boost productivity
  • Strong organization and planning skills, ability to establish a clear course of action to accomplish goals and objectives
  • Ability to effectively manage time and utilize resources and systems
  • Knowledge of task prioritization, ability to keep track of activities, and task completion
  • Self-starter with the know-how to work independently and multi-task while maintaining quality standards
  • Fluent in spoken and written English
Vacante publicada el hace un mes

¿Desea recibir más vacantes?

Suscríbase y reciba vacantes similares a Senior Data Engineer. ¡Sea el primero en aplicar!

subscribeToSimilarBanner
Regístrese para acceder a todas las funciones de nuestro servicio
  • Búsqueda de ofertas de trabajo
  • Favoritos
  • Crear un CV
    Nuevo
  • Alertas de empleo